Skip to content

anhsirk0/awesome-config

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

39 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

my config for awesome window manager

Features

Very Minimal - no fancy effects, no fancy widgets, not even icons (all the themes follow same pattern)
Modular (mostly) - Different files for keybindings, rules, rc.lua
Rofi Scripts for some Useful tasks - control Volume, Brightness, Wifi, Emoji, BrowserMenu, Lollypop music
Rofi Scripts moved to its own repo
Themes are divided in 2 groups (themes and old_themes)
Total 60 themes (8 modus-themes) (36 ef-themes) (10 doric-themes) (8 old themes)
Old themes will no longer be maintained

Screenshots

Pictures (wezterm): https://wezfurlong.org/wezterm/colorschemes/e/index.html#ef-autumn
Modus-themes pictures (emacs): https://protesilaos.com/emacs/modus-themes-pictures
Ef-themes pictures (emacs): https://protesilaos.com/emacs/ef-themes-pictures
Doric-themes pictures (emacs): https://protesilaos.com/emacs/doric-themes-pictures

Modus-Operandi & Modus-Vivendi theme

operandi-vivendi.png

Ef-Summer & Ef-Winter theme

summer-winter.png

Ef-Spring & Ef-Autumn theme

spring-autumn.png

Ef-Trio light & dark theme

trio-light-dark.png

Ef-Tritanopia light & dark theme

tritanopia-light-dark.png

Ef-Bio & Ef-Cherie theme

bio-cherie.png

Following themes are now part of old_themes

Moonlight theme

moonlight.png

Aqua theme

aqua.png

Pastel theme

pastel1.png pastel2.png

Warm theme

warm1.png warm2.png

One-dark theme

onedark1.png onedark2.png

Gruv theme

gruv1.png gruv2.png

Boxes theme

boxes2.png

change-theme.pl

use scripts/change-theme.pl to change the themes (fzf optionally required)

$ ~/.config/awesome/scripts/change-theme.pl 

This will use fzf to select a theme (from ~/.config/awesome/themes) interactively (fzf)

$ ~/.config/awesome/scripts/change-theme.pl viv
'vivendi' theme selected

This will change theme to the first theme that has viv in its name

$ ~/.config/awesome/scripts/change-theme.pl gruv
'gruv' theme selected

This will change theme to the first theme that has gruv in its name, like gruvbox

Some defaults info

Default font - Aporetic
Newer themes are for resolution 1920x1080 while some are for 1366x768, change the font size, gaps etc etc accordingly
modified from awesome-copycats

Thanks

Modus themes - https://protesilaos.com/emacs/modus-themes
Ef themes - https://protesilaos.com/emacs/ef-themes
Doric themes - https://github.com/protesilaos/doric-themes

See also

Modus, Ef, Doric themes for Alacritty: https://github.com/anhsirk0/alacritty-themes
Modus, Ef, Doric themes for Wezterm: https://github.com/anhsirk0/wezterm-themes
Modus, Ef, Doric themes for Ghostty: https://github.com/anhsirk0/ghostty-themes
Modus, Ef, Doric themes for Awesomewm: https://github.com/anhsirk0/awesome-config
Modus, Ef, Doric themes for Rofi: https://github.com/anhsirk0/rofi-config
Modus, Ef, Doric themes for Xresources: https://github.com/anhsirk0/xresources-themes
Modus, Ef themes for Kakoune: https://github.com/anhsirk0/kakoune-themes

About

My config for awesomewm

Topics

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ages